West Memphis Three Released From Jail!

The West Memphis Three were released from Jail on Friday after recent tests on DNA evidence, including material from the crime scene, was found not to match the defendants. The bodies of three eight-year-olds were found mutilated and murdered in West Memphis, Arkansas in the early nineties. Three teenagers, Damien Echols, Jessie Misskelley Jr. and […]

Load more